About 7 Cooper Way
7 Cooper Way is an end-of-terrace house in Slough (SL1 9JA). It has a recorded floor area of 75 m² (around 807 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(September 2014)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from September 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
At 75 m² it's 27.1% larger than the typical home in the postcode (59 m² median across 60 EPCs).
